Prolonged Postoperative Mechanical Ventilation (PPMV) in Children Undergoing Abdominal Operations: An Analysis of the American College of Surgeons National Surgical Quality Improvement Program (ACS-NSQIP) Database
Topic overview
Large database study identifies key risk factors for prolonged postoperative ventilation in children after abdominal surgery. Neonatal age emerged as the strongest predictor (20-fold increased odds), followed by preoperative inotropic support, prolonged operative time, and high ASA classification.
